Reaching Out Across the Miles: Finding Your Long-Lost Friend
Sometimes life carries us on paths that separate us apart from friends we once held dear. Years pass by, memories blur, and the thought of finding them again can seem daunting. But don't let distance deter you! With a little effort and a whole lot of hope, you can rekindle with your long-lost friend.
It all starts with remembering. What do you remember about them? Their year of birth? A favorite hobby you shared? Any common interests that could be a starting point? Gather any clues you have, and then research into online resources.
Social media networks can be a powerful tool. A simple search might lead you directly to their profile. If not, try reaching out to mutual friends or family members who might have more recent contact. Don't be afraid to keep trying, as sometimes finding someone takes a bit of resourcefulness.

Bridging the Distance: How to Find Someone You've Lost Contact With
Losing touch with someone is a common experience, but it doesn't have to be permanent. With a little effort and the right tools, you can find that old friend or family member you've been thinking about. Start by reflecting where they might be. Do you know their family history? Utilize social media platforms like Facebook and LinkedIn, online directories can also be helpful resources. If you're optimistic, you may even find a mutual acquaintance who can provide an update or make an introduction. Remember to stay persistent – sometimes it takes time and effort to bridge the distance.
- Explore joining online communities or forums related to your shared interests, hobbies, or alma mater.
- Make contact through social media platforms, even if it's just a brief hello or a request for information.
- Be respectful if you don't hear back immediately. People may have different reasons for their limited online presence.
